QuantOracle Live — fresh market data + compute

Every endpoint above is pure math on inputs you supply — the 73 calculators have zero data dependencies, which is what makes them deterministic and cacheable. QuantOracle Live is the one tier that brings the data: you pass a ticker, the API fetches fresh market data and runs the math, so your agent never has to source or maintain a data feed.

Endpoint

Description

Price

POST /v1/live/volatility

Realized volatility (7d/30d/90d) + regime for a crypto asset, from fresh daily candles

$0.01

POST /v1/live/funding-rates

Current perpetual funding rate + annualized carry for a crypto asset

$0.005

curl -X POST https://api.quantoracle.dev/v1/live/volatility \
  -H "Content-Type: application/json" \
  -d '{"asset":"BTC"}'

# → {"asset":"BTC","spot":61728.7,"realized_vol_7d":0.4534,
#    "realized_vol_30d":0.3108,"realized_vol_90d":0.3157,"regime":"NORMAL",
#    "as_of_age_seconds":0,"stale":false,"source":"kraken", ...}

Pricing: the Live tier is paid from the first call — it is not part of the 1,000/day calculator free tier (the value is the fresh data + pipeline, which you can't replicate with a local library). You get 20 free calls per IP per day to evaluate, then it settles per-call via x402 (USDC on Base or Solana). You pay for freshness, not arithmetic.

Results are cached server-side (volatility ~5 min, funding ~1 min); if an upstream feed is briefly unavailable, the API serves the last good value flagged stale: true, with as_of_age_seconds telling you how fresh the answer is.

QuantOracle Watch — 24/7 position monitoring

Most monitoring agents rebuild the same loop: poll crypto/liquidation-price + risk/var-parametric on a timer, all day. Watch replaces the loop — register a crypto perp position once and an isolated watcher re-evaluates it every ~60 seconds: funding-adjusted liquidation distance (warn/critical bands with hysteresis), funding-rate sign flips, hourly vol-regime changes, and expiry warnings. Alerts fire as HMAC-signed webhooks (X-QO-Signature, key = your monitor token) and are recorded server-side, so the trial needs zero infrastructure — just poll.

No exchange keys, no custody, no execution — Watch reads public market data and sends webhooks, so the worst failure mode is a missed alert (the watcher heartbeat is published in /health as watcher_heartbeat_age_s). Webhook targets are SSRF-guarded and deliveries retried. The economics: a DIY loop polling the same math once a minute past the free tier costs ~$7.20/day in per-call fees vs $5 per 30 days. x402 Payments

QuantOracle uses the x402 protocol for pay-per-call micropayments. When an agent exhausts its free tier (or calls a paid-only composite), the API returns a standard 402 response with payment instructions advertising both Base and Solana. x402-compatible agents (Coinbase AgentKit, AgentCash, OpenClaw, etc.) handle the rest automatically:

  1. Agent calls endpoint, gets 402 with PAYMENT-REQUIRED header listing accepted networks

  2. Agent signs a gasless USDC transfer authorization on Base (EIP-3009) or Solana

  3. Agent resends request with PAYMENT-SIGNATURE header

  4. Server verifies via CDP facilitator, serves the response, settles on-chain

No API keys. No subscriptions. No accounts. Just math and micropayments.

Example: Agent Backtest Workflow

A typical agent backtest chains multiple QuantOracle calls per iteration:

1. /v1/indicators/technical    -- generate signals (SMA, RSI, MACD)
2. /v1/risk/position-size      -- size the trade (fixed fractional)
3. /v1/risk/transaction-cost   -- estimate execution costs
4. /v1/options/price            -- price the hedge (Black-Scholes)
5. /v1/risk/portfolio           -- compute running Sharpe, drawdown, VaR
6. /v1/stats/probabilistic-sharpe -- is the Sharpe statistically significant?
7. /v1/tvm/cagr                 -- compute CAGR of the equity curve

Each call is a pure calculator -- no state, no side effects, no API keys.
